Common Factors for Kitchenaid Fridge Making Noise
One usual factor for a Kitchenaid refrigerator making sounds is a malfunctioning condenser fan electric motor. This component aids to cool off the compressor and the condenser coils, and when it breakdowns, it can produce a loud humming or buzzing sound. If you notice your Kitchenaid refrigerator making unusual audios, this could be a possible reason to examine.

Another possible culprit for a loud Kitchenaid fridge is a malfunctioning evaporator follower motor. This component is responsible for flowing the cold air throughout the refrigerator and freezer areas. If the evaporator follower motor is experiencing concerns, it may lead to strange noises rising from your Kitchenaid home appliance. A defective evaporator fan motor can interfere with the normal procedure of the refrigerator and effect its cooling performance.

Managing a Kitchenaid Fridge Leaking Water
One usual issue that Kitchenaid fridge proprietors might come across is water dripping from the refrigerator. This can typically suggest a clogged up or frozen defrost drain. To resolve this, you can try to manually get rid of the drain using a combination of cozy water and moderate soap. Gently pour this service away to help remove any kind of blockages and enable the water to flow openly once more.

If the problem persists even after trying to get rid of the drain, it might be necessary to seek the know-how of a qualified kitchenaid device repair service technician. They can detect the problem precisely and supply an extra complete solution to avoid more water leak. Dealing With a Kitchenaid Refrigerator Not Cooling Down Effectively
If your Kitchenaid fridge is not cooling down effectively, it could be as a result of a range of factors. One typical concern that can cause this problem is a malfunctioning compressor The compressor is responsible for flowing cooling agent via the system to cool the air inside the refrigerator. If the compressor is not functioning correctly, your refrigerator may not have the ability to keep the correct temperature level.

One more prospective reason for a Kitchenaid fridge not cooling down effectively could be a buildup of ice on the evaporator coils When the evaporator coils become covered in frost or ice, they are incapable to successfully absorb warm from the inside of the fridge. This can avoid your fridge from cooling down properly and might require you to thaw the coils to bring back correct feature. Comprehending Kitchenaid Fridge Ice Manufacturer Issues
One typical concern that Kitchenaid fridge proprietors might encounter is the ice maker not working appropriately. This trouble can be frustrating, particularly throughout hot summertime when ice is in high demand. If you are encountering this concern, it is essential to initial check the supply of water to the fridge as not enough water flow can impede ice production. Furthermore, make certain the fridge freezer temperature level is readied to the advised level to make sure correct ice development.

Another possible root cause of a malfunctioning Kitchenaid refrigerator ice manufacturer could be a faulty water inlet valve. This valve controls the water flow right into the ice manufacturer and might require to be changed if it is not operating appropriately.
